The suspected shooter was seeking to assassinate Trump and other officials

On Sunday, US government spokeswoman Carolyn Levitt described the attack that occurred during a dinner in Washington as an attempt to assassinate President Donald Trump and senior officials in his government.
Levitt said on the X platform that the dinner party held on Saturday “was attacked by a crazy and deviant person who sought to assassinate the president and kill as many senior Trump administration officials as possible.”
Levitt, who was also sitting in the VIP podium, explained that she was taken to a safe place with Trump and First Lady Melania, and added: “President Trump has been truly brave, but as he said last night, this political violence must end.”
For his part, Attorney General Todd Blanche stated earlier that the suspect’s motive is still under investigation.
Blanche noted that based on preliminary findings, investigators assume the alleged gunman was targeting members of the Trump administration.
A heavily armed man stormed a security checkpoint during a dinner party with the capital’s press on Saturday evening, before security forces took control of him.
Shooting took place during the incident, while bodyguards transferred the president to a safe place.
